What does the role involve?
- To assist in the setting up of examination rooms
- To ensure all candidates receive appropriate examination question papers and answer paper
- To be aware of any needs that candidates may have during an examination
- To ensure answer scripts are collected in candidate number order and are supervised as
- required until they are delivered to the registry
- To ensure candidates obey the regulations of an examination room as laid out in the examination guidelines
- To maintain security and confidentiality
- To record attendance on the official examination registers
- To ensure no inappropriate items are brought into the examination hall, such as mobile phones, personal stereos, revision notes or other paperwork unless told otherwise
- Ensure all candidates are aware of the pre-exam start information and of any erratum notice that may affect them
- To ensure there is no talking or disruption for the candidates once an examination has begun
- To ensure all candidates are seated before opening the question papers
- To ensure that invigilators DO NOT help candidates in any way with the question paper
- To sign the centre’s confidentiality declaration
- To assist in other activities as may reasonably be requested by the centre from time to time
